              Diaz is just all wrong stylistically for a guy like Penn.

              Penn has good boxing and BJJ, but Diaz happens to be better at both. Not to mention the huge difference in gas tanks and workrate.

              A prime Penn would have looked just as bad against Diaz.

              If they fought at 155, it would of been more competitive especially in the early rounds, but Diaz would have still put a beating on him.
